‘Cashless Town’ to kick off in Ho Chi Minh City this week
This image shows a section of Le Loi Boulevard in District 1, Ho Chi Minh City, where installation was underway on June 12, 2023 for the Cashless Festival that will take place from June 16 to 18, 2023, within the framework of the 2023 Cashless Day. Photo: Quang Dinh / Tuoi Tre

‘Cashless Town,’ a part of the 2023 Cashless Day, will kick off on Friday in Ho Chi Minh City as the first such event in Vietnam, where all deals for goods or services will be paid without cash while payers will be offered various incentives.  

The preparations for the Cashless Town have been accelerated so that the unique event can be opened on Friday, June 16, the annual Cashless Day, which was initiated by Tuoi Tre (Youth) newspaper in 2019 to help promote non-cash payment practices and build a non-cash society in Vietnam.

The Cashless Day, jointly organized by the State Bank of Vietnam’s Payment Department and Tuoi Tre, will focus on 'Data Connection, Smart Payment' in response to the government’s plan for the promotion of digital transformation and data connectivity this year.

At dawn on Monday, workers erected a large stage for the Cashless Town festival on Le Loi Boulevard near Ben Thanh Market in downtown District 1, while 12-ton trucks carrying facilities and equipment to the site streamed in all morning.

About 50 workers have been trying to complete the work for the three-day festival and they could work overnight to ensure the work progress, according to the event’s organizers.

The Cashless Town simulates a miniature society that meets all the demands for financial services, public services, dining, sightseeing, and entertainment, and all relevant payment transactions take place quickly and conveniently via automated teller machine (ATM) cards or just after a touch on a payment app.

Visitors to Cashless Town will enjoy culinary and shopping experiences at dozens of stalls from famous brands and participate in a series of exciting entertainment activities such as karaoke, gift exchanges, and sketch paintings.

They can also seize the opportunity to open a bank card with extremely preferential limits from major banks accompanying the program. 

During the days, users of cashless payment methods will enjoy various preferential programs from banks and credit institutions, retailers, and service providers. 

Saigon - Hanoi Commercial Joint Stock Bank (SHB) has said it will give thousands of gifts such as piggy banks, mini hand-held fans, raincoats, umbrellas, T-shirts, and suitcases, among others, to customers who open accounts, make online savings, or participate in games at their booth during the festival.

Similarly, the National Payment Corporation of Vietnam (NAPAS) said it will give 3,000 gifts to festival-goers such as water bottles, teddy bears, hats, and T-shirts.

MoMo e-wallet said that customers who come to experience MoMo's coffee carts at the festival can drink coffee for only VND1,000 (US$0.04) that is paid via scanning a cashless payment, and that all the revenue will be used to build a library.

In addition, MoMo will also offer gifts to customers through its Lucky Spinning Wheel program.

Meanwhile, many other banks and their accompanying units will offer their 'rains of gifts' to customers experiencing their cashless payment methods at the event.

In addition, festival-goers will have a chance to enjoy exciting music shows after 8:00 pm every day on all three days of the event, along with exchange sessions with beauty queens.

In addition, Gen C (Cashless Generation) customers who check in at Cashless Town will have the opportunity to win attractive presents worth up to VND1 million ($43) each.

Along with the Cashless Town, there will be several other key events within the framework of the Cashless Day, including the 'Cashless Warriors' contest that will last until July 15, whose results will be announced on July 21. 

Contestants are required to make short videos showing at least three cashless transactions and their comments on the practical benefits that they can enjoy from those transactions.

Another attractive event will be the Big Boom promotional program slated for June 16, when consumers can purchase goods with incentives from sellers and intermediary payment service providers, and take part in other attractive activities offered by banks, card issuers, e-wallet companies, and retailers.

The 'Data Connection, Smart Payment to Promote Social Development' national conference is scheduled to take place on June 16 at the Rex Hotel in District 1, with about 400 invited guests.

Cashless payment activities have continued developing robustly in Vietnam during the first quarter of the year, with the number of transactions through the interbank electronic payment system growing 8.55 percent year on year, while payments made through Point of Sale (POS) venues increased 37.57 percent in volume and 32.09 percent in value, according to national radio Voice of Vietnam.
